In 2023, Encompass Health is offering research funding grant(s) totaling up to $50,000 aimed at the investigation of the impact or effectiveness of therapies in the inpatient rehabilitation facility (IRF) post-acute care setting, knowledge translation or implementation science. WASHINGTON, D.C. -- The U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) is seeking applications for its Pool Safely Grant Program (PSGP or grant program) to assist state and local governments in reducing deaths and injuries from drowning and drain entrapment incidents in pools and spas. This child safety law has helped reduce the risk of drowning and drain entrapment by requiring public pools and spas to install new safety drain covers and through federal grants and education programs to encourage states and localities to require residential pools and spas to utilize physical barriers, such as a fence completely surrounding the pool, with self-closing, self-latching gates.
